区块链是一种分布式账本技术,其核心原则是去中心化和透明性。为了确保区块链系统的有效性和安全性,了解其正常运行的方法是至关重要的。这不仅包括技术方面的要求,还涉及到使用者的行为、智能合约的设计及网络的维护等多个方面。
区块链网络由多个节点组成,这些节点负责验证交易和维护链条。确保节点的质量和性能至关重要。在选择节点时,应该考虑节点的计算能力、存储能力和网络连通性。此外,需要定期对节点进行维护和更新,以确保其能够处理高负载并保持运行状态。
共识机制是区块链操作的核心。不同的区块链采用不同的共识算法(如工作量证明、权益证明等)。为了使区块链正常运行,必须确保共识机制的有效和安全运行。对共识算法的定期评估和可能的,可以提升系统的性能和安全性。
区块链的安全性非常重要。要确保正常运行,区块链系统必须实施严密的安全措施。这包括加密数据传输、智能合约的审计、私钥管理等。此外,定期测试系统的安全性,确保没有新的漏洞被引入,也是一种有效的措施。
区块链存储的数据通常是分布式的,如何有效地存储这些数据并控制访问是确保系统正常运行的关键。一方面,数据需要以高效的方式存储以便迅速访问;另一方面,需要通过权限管理来控制谁可以访问特定数据,以防止数据泄露。
网络性能直接影响区块链的交易处理能力。通过负载均衡、多链架构或分片技术,可以网络性能,从而提高交易的处理速度和系统的全天候可用性。此外,还应定期监测网络延迟,及时发现并解决问题。
共识机制是区块链设计中的重要考虑因素。选择合适的共识机制需要根据区块链的具体应用场景、交易量和对安全性的需求来进行权衡。比如,公共区块链通常倾向于使用工作量证明,而私有区块链则可能采取更灵活的机制如权益证明。此外,还需考虑到节能与高效性的问题。调研和模拟不同共识机制的表现可以帮助决策。
区块链的安全性保障涉及多个层面。首先是技术层面,包括采用强加密算法、设计合理的权限管理机制及智能合约审计。其次是过程层面的安全监控,通过实时监控链上活动来发现异常行为。此外,社区的参与和监督也是保障安全的重要环节,利用集体智慧来提升安全性。
数据隐私在区块链中是一项复杂的挑战。尽管区块链提供了一定程度的透明度,但在某些应用中,保护用户的隐私是至关重要的。一种常见的解决方案是使用零知识证明等加密技术,在不泄露用户隐私的情况下进行交易验证。此外,私有区块链的选择也是保护隐私的一种有效手段。
网络拥堵问题是影响区块链性能的一个重要因素。解决这一问题的方法包括扩大区块大小、降低区块生成时间、使用分片技术等。此外,可以通过设置交易优先级、引入二层解决方案(如闪电网络)来缓解压力。强化网络的可扩展性和灵活性是提升整体性能的关键。
随着区块链技术的广泛应用,其能耗问题愈发受到关注。为了解决这个问题,许多项目开始探索更为节能的共识机制(如权益证明)。此外,可以通过节点资源的使用,以及采用绿能技术来降低整体能耗。同时,社区和开发者也应加强关注,推动技术的可持续发展。
通过对上述问题的深入探讨,读者可以更全面地理解区块链正常运行的方法及其挑战。随着区块链技术的不断发展,相关的最佳实践也在不断演变。未来,只有不断创新和,才能实现区块链的广泛应用与持续健康发展。